Population
- Total Population3,141,000
- Male Population(50.4 %) 1,582,476
- Female Population(49.6 %) 1,558,524
- Median Age38.00
There are currently 3,141,000 people living in Nevada. Out of the total population number, 1,582,476 are men and 1,558,524 are women. The median age for Nevada dwellers is 38.00.

Households
- Total Households1,183,393
- Family Households756,370
- Non-family Households427,023
- Households With Children352,039
- Households Without Children831,354
- Average People Per Household2.00
There are currently 1,183,393 households in Nevada. Out of this total, 756,370 are family households, 427,023 are non-family households, 352,039 are households with children and 831,354 are households without children. The average number of people per household in Nevada is 2.00.

Income/Financial
- Average Household Income$102,911
- Median Household Income$75,561
- Median Income Under 25$51,016
- Median Income 25-44$79,717
- Median Income 45-64$88,942
- Median Income Over 65$58,830
The average household income for people living in Nevada is $102,911, while the median household income is $75,561. The median income in Nevada is $51,016 for those under 25, $79,717 for those aged 25 to 44, $88,942 for those aged 45 to 64, and $58,830 for those over the age of 65.
